What is a positive number?

Back

A positive number is a number greater than zero, representing a quantity or value that is above zero.

What is a negative number?

Back

A negative number is a number less than zero, representing a quantity or value that is below zero.

What does it mean to owe money in terms of negative numbers?

Back

Owing money is represented as a negative number, indicating a debt.

If you owe $50 and receive $30, how do you find your new balance?

Back

New balance = -50 + 30 = -20, which means you still owe $20.
